Licensing a 'set' or 'bundle' of patterns

  • August 16, 2021
  • 1 reply
  • 513 views

Hello,

 

I have licensed a few 'sets' of seamless patterns, (Eg- file 354168964).

 

When I download the file, it is only the cover image displaying all of the patterns at once.  

 

I was under the impression that licensing/purchasing a set or bundle would provide you with the separate files for each?  

 

If anyone has any advice on a way around this, it would be greatly appreciated.

Correct answer Abambo

Just to give some precisions and to correct my answer above:

  • Cropping in Photoshop does not work
  • In Illustrator, the elements are squares with repeating patterns that can be stitched seamlessly together.
  • There is no clipping mask

The conclusion is that you absolutely need to work with Illustrator to get useful access to these assets.
